Understanding the Presence of Hamas in Lebanon

The presence of Hamas in Lebanon is a multifaceted issue with historical, political, and social dimensions. To understand why Hamas operates in Lebanon, it's essential to explore the historical context, their role in the region, and the implications for Lebanon's political landscape.

Historical Context of Hamas in Lebanon

Hamas, an Islamist Palestinian organization, has had ties to Lebanon for several decades. The relationship dates back to the 1980s when Palestinian refugees, including members of Hamas, sought refuge in Lebanon during conflicts with Israel. The Palestinian camps in Lebanon became significant centers for political and militant activities, providing a base for Hamas to operate and organize.

The Role of Hamas in Lebanon

Hamas in Lebanon primarily focuses on supporting Palestinian refugees and maintaining its resistance against Israel. The organization has established networks within Palestinian camps, providing social services, education, and religious guidance. This support helps Hamas maintain influence and recruit members from the refugee population.

Political Influence of Hamas in Lebanon

Hamas's presence in Lebanon affects the country's political dynamics. While Hamas is primarily focused on Palestinian issues, its activities can influence Lebanese politics, especially concerning the Palestinian refugee situation. The organization often collaborates with other groups, including Hezbollah, to strengthen its position and pursue common goals against Israel.

Impact on Lebanese Society

The presence of Hamas in Lebanon has social implications, particularly in the Palestinian refugee camps. These camps, often marginalized and under-resourced, rely on organizations like Hamas for essential services. However, this also means that the camps can become hotspots for political and militant activities, affecting the broader Lebanese society.

Recent Developments and Challenges

In recent years, the situation in the Middle East has evolved, impacting Hamas in Lebanon. Regional conflicts, shifting alliances, and internal Lebanese politics all play a role in shaping Hamas's activities. The Syrian civil war, for instance, has affected Hamas's relationships and strategies, as the organization navigates a complex geopolitical landscape.

Future Prospects for Hamas in Lebanon

The future of Hamas in Lebanon remains uncertain. As regional dynamics continue to shift, Hamas must adapt to changing circumstances. The organization's ability to maintain its influence will depend on its relationships with other political entities, both within Lebanon and across the Middle East.

Conclusion

Understanding why Hamas is in Lebanon requires a nuanced view of historical ties, current roles, and future challenges. While their presence is rooted in the Palestinian refugee issue, it also intersects with broader regional politics. As the situation evolves, the impact of Hamas in Lebanon will continue to be a significant factor in the region's stability.
